AI Develops New Drugs for “Intractable” Diseases Like Parkinson’s

Published

on

Artificial intelligence (AI) is ushering in a new era of drug discovery, delivering breakthrough progress for diseases once deemed “untreatable.” BBC reports indicate that Insilico Medicine, MIT, and multiple international research teams are leveraging AI to accelerate new drug discovery across fields including Parkinson’s disease, drug-resistant bacteria, and rare diseases.

In the fight against antibiotic-resistant bacteria, MIT medical engineering professor James Collins and his team employed generative AI to screen over 45 million compounds targeting gonorrhea bacteria and methicillin-resistant Staphylococcus aureus (MRSA). Ultimately, they synthesized 24 candidate compounds, seven of which demonstrated antibacterial activity, with two showing significant efficacy against highly resistant strains. These compounds attack bacteria differently than traditional antibiotics, potentially bypassing resistance defenses and offering new drug candidates.

For Parkinson’s research, Cambridge University biophysicist Michele Venderuscololo employed AI to analyze misfolded proteins called Lewy bodies, identifying small-molecule drugs that could halt neurodegeneration. AI rapidly narrowed the candidate molecule pool and accurately predicted binding potential with target proteins, identifying five novel compounds with clinical promise.

Additionally, AI is advancing repurposing strategies by using machine learning to match approved drugs with rare diseases, uncovering novel treatment pathways for patients. Research teams from Harvard Medical School and Canada’s McGill University also employed AI to identify potential drugs for idiopathic pulmonary fibrosis (IPF) and other rare diseases, achieving preliminary clinical trial results—such as Ensilio Intelligence’s “Rentosertib” demonstrating efficacy in Phase II trials.

Victorian Liberal Candidate Counselled Over Volunteer Internship Program

Published

on

Victorian Liberal Party candidate for Glen Waverley, Jacky Sun, has been counselled by the party following questions over a “volunteer internship program” recruiting international students for political volunteering.

The issue arose at a Mandarin-speaking university student orientation event held in North Melbourne this Saturday. Bilingual posters were distributed promoting a “volunteer internship program” running from August to November. Tasks included door-knocking, letter-dropping and attending campaign fundraising events. Participants were also offered opportunities to meet politicians and obtain reference letters.

The posters did not identify any political party or candidate. However, a Liberal campaign poster featuring Jacky Sun was displayed on the other side of an A-frame sign holding the volunteer posters. One student said that after asking the recruiters, she was told the program was for “the opposition”, would mainly operate in Glen Waverley, and required participants to speak Mandarin.

A Liberal spokesperson did not directly answer whether the program was recruiting volunteers for Jacky Sun or the Liberal Party. The spokesperson said Sun was not present at the event and stressed that “this is not Liberal Party material”. The party also confirmed that Sun had been “counselled” over the matter, but did not explain the specific reason.

The issue also involves Jacky Sun’s wife, scientist Danzi Song. The email address listed on the English poster was associated with “Daisy Song Consulting”, while Danzi Song uses the English name Daisy Song on LinkedIn. However, the ABC could not independently confirm whether the email address belongs to her, and she did not respond to inquiries.

Colombia Earthquake Death Toll Rises to 250

Published

on

A powerful 7.4-magnitude earthquake struck western Colombia, with the official death toll rising to at least 250. Rescue workers worked through the night searching for survivors in collapsed buildings and rubble, racing against time during the critical rescue window. Authorities warned that the death toll could continue to rise as search and clearance operations continue.

The UN Office for the Coordination of Humanitarian Affairs initially estimated that around 5,000 homes were damaged, with dozens of buildings collapsing and hundreds of other homes sustaining varying degrees of damage, highlighting the severe impact on infrastructure and residential areas.

Rescue operations remain focused on the worst-hit areas, where emergency workers are using heavy machinery and manually clearing rubble in an effort to find survivors who may still be trapped inside buildings. As the extent of the damage in some areas remains under assessment, the full number of casualties and the scale of property losses have yet to be determined.

The international community has also begun providing emergency assistance. The United States announced US$15.5 million in aid to provide temporary shelters and food in affected areas, as well as support damage assessment efforts. The Inter-American Development Bank said it had prepared US$50 million in funding that could be made available for post-earthquake reconstruction if needed.

The local government is currently prioritising search and rescue operations, medical care and temporary accommodation. As further assessments are carried out in affected areas, authorities will gradually determine the overall extent of the destruction caused by the earthquake.

Australian Police Trial Real-Time AI Facial Recognition

Published

on

Western Australia Police have launched Australia’s first public-facing trial of real-time AI facial recognition, using cameras in Perth and Fremantle to scan pedestrians’ faces in real time and compare them against police watchlists, raising concerns over privacy and the expansion of surveillance powers.

Police began using technology company NEC’s NeoFace m40 system in June. In its first week, the system scanned more than 130,000 faces and compared them against a watchlist of around 4,000 people. The list includes people suspected of serious crimes, missing persons, and individuals police believe may pose a risk to themselves or others.

Police said the trial had delivered encouraging initial results, triggering 33 alerts and contributing to 18 arrests. Authorities said real-time facial recognition could help officers identify people of interest more quickly, improving public safety and law enforcement efficiency.

However, privacy experts and legal advocacy groups have questioned how police decide who is placed on the watchlist, how the data is stored, and the risk of misidentification, arguing that there is insufficient transparency. The choice of trial locations has also attracted scrutiny, with concerns that the technology could result in disproportionate surveillance of Indigenous communities.

Unlike “one-to-one” facial recognition, which is used simply to verify an individual’s identity, real-time “one-to-many” systems can scan and compare faces on a large scale in public places.
